What are the service times?

Currently we are offering two, distinct services at 9:30am and 11:00am.

9:30am - A service featuring a combination of hymns and modern worship songs led primarily by the choir, and some traditional liturgy. 

11:00am - A more informal service, featuring modern worship songs led by the worship band. Together, we praise, hear the Word, and respond in song and prayer. 
In both services, children are invited to join their families in church for a time before being dismissed to children's ministry programs part way through the service.

Do you have children and youth programs on Sundays?

We believe that Sunday mornings provide an opportunity for children to experience worship alongside their families and also to learn about God in an age-appropriate environment. We offer the children’s programs below, but children are always welcome to remain with their parents in the service.

Sunday school is currently offered for children up to Grade 8.  Children are welcome to first join the worship service in the sanctuary or go directly to Sunday school for a time of bible learning, crafts and fun with other children of similar ages.
